主要内容:所需步骤,示例代码在本教程将演示如何在JDBC应用程序中创建一个数据库表。 在执行以下示例之前,请确保您已经准备好以下操作: 具有数据库管理员权限,以在给定模式中创建数据库表。 要执行以下示例,需要用实际用户名和密码替换这里用户名()和密码()。 MySQL或数据库已启动并运行。 所需步骤 使用JDBC应用程序创建新数据库需要以下步骤: 导入包:需要包含包含数据库编程所需的JDBC类的包。 大多数情况下,使用就足够
主要内容:1. ServletActionContext,2. ServletResponseAware,参考在Struts2中,可以用以下两种方式来获取HttpServletResponse对象。 1. ServletActionContext 通过 ServletActionContext 类来访问 HttpServletResponse 。 2. ServletResponseAware 通过实现 ServletResponseAware 接口并覆盖 setServletResponse(
主要内容:1. ServletActionContext,2. ServletRequestAware,参考在Struts2中,可以使用以下两种方法来获取HttpServletRequest对象。 1. ServletActionContext 直接从 org.apache.struts2.ServletActionContext 获取 HttpServletRequest 对象。 2. ServletRequestAware 让你的类实现org.apache.struts2.intercept
主要内容:1. 工程目录结构,2. MySQL表结构脚本,4. Hibernate 相关配置,5. Hibernate ServletContextListener,6. Action,7. JSP 页面,8. struts.xml,9. 实例测试执行,参考在 Struts2 中,没有官方的插件集成Hibernate框架。但是,可以通过以下步骤解决方法: 注册一个自定义的 ServletContextListener 在 ServletContextListener 类, 初始化Hibernat
主要内容:1. 工程结构,2. Spring监听器,3. 注册Spring Bean,4. Struts.xml,5. 示例,用例1,用例 2,参考在本教程中,我们来学习Struts2和Spring的集成。 1. 工程结构 下面的图是本教程的项目文件夹结构。 2. Spring监听器 配置Spring监听器 “org.springframework.web.context.ContextLoaderListener” 到 web.xml 文件中。 web.xml 3. 注册Spring Bean
主要内容:1. 动作类,2. Bean,3. <s:property>标签示例,4. struts.xml,5. 示例,参考Struts2的<s:property>标签是用来从一个类获得属性值,如果没有指定,这将默认为当前Action类(堆栈的顶部)属性。在本教程中,它展示了如何使用 <s:property> 标签,以从目前Action类获得其他bean类的属性值。 1. 动作类 这里有一个Action类,有一个 name 属性。 PropertyTagAction.java 2. Bean 一
1.首先自我介绍,我做了一个简短的ppt展示项目经历和成果 2.专业问题 第一个问题是将CAD的文件转到ArcGIS里面投影如何操作。 第二个问题是用ENVI软件提取建筑面将其转成shp文件是否可以实现。 3.对公司产品的了解及感受 4.面试官向我介绍了公司的主要业务已经应聘岗位所需要掌握的技能 5.未来的职业规划 6.反问问题 #面经#
一面: 1.自我介绍 2.项目介绍 3.项目中如何实现分页展示 4.手撕算法 1.二叉树的层序遍历 2.倒过来的层序遍历 二面: 1.自我介绍 2.常见的排序算法有哪些 3.算法题: 使用O(log(n)时间复杂度实现对链表的排序 4.进程和线程
一面: 1.自我介绍 2.spring IOC AOP 3.spring 事务隔离 4.脏读 不可重复读 幻读 是什么 区别是什么 5.redis 分布式锁 6.mysql 设计表 7.代码题 用链表实现队列 8.高并发情况下,如何实现线程安全,如何保证效率 9.springboot启动很慢 有什么方法(一个其他的轻量级框架) 原理:只有类被用到的时候才加载 10.项目一系列问题 二面: 1.自我
一面1.13,40min 先聊项目 什么是惊群现象,怎么解决 epoll的工作原理 说一下对进程的了解 进程间的通信方式 最快的通信方式是什么 说一下vector 、list、map的区别 说一下迭代器失效的情况,以及解决方法 哈希冲突的解决方法(我说了链表法,开放地址法,再哈希法) 空类包括什么成员 浅拷贝和深拷贝有什么区别 悬空指针所指向的内存被释放了,那么这个指针还存在吗 悬空指针和野指针的
问题内容: 在 UNIX到Windows移植词典HPC 页的叉()这是写 没有与Unix fork()或vfork()等效的Windows API。用于基于Unix的应用程序的Microsoft子系统(SUA或Interix)是一个Unix环境,具有正确实现的fork()和vfork()。 在页面的后面还有使用标准Win32 API 函数的示例源代码。 我糊涂了。 该示例不应该使用fork()来说
问题内容: 我有一个正在运行的EC2实例,并且能够通过SSH进入该实例。 但是,当我尝试rsync时,它给我错误Permission Densed(publickey)。 我正在使用的命令是: 我也试过 谢谢, 问题答案: 我刚收到同样的错误。我一直能够使用以下命令: 但是,当使用更长的 rsync 结构时,似乎会导致错误。我最终将ssh语句括在引号中,并使用键的完整路径。在您的示例中: 这似乎可
问题内容: 我正在考虑将我的产品从RTOS迁移到嵌入式Linux。我没有很多实时要求,而我有几个RT要求大约是10毫秒。 有人可以给我指出一个参考,该参考可以告诉我当前版本的Linux如何实时吗? 从转向商业RTOS到Linux还有其他陷阱吗? 问题答案: 您可以从Real Time Linux Wiki和FAQ中获得大部分答案。 库存的2.6 linux内核的实时功能是什么? 传统上,Linux
问题内容: 我想实时收听一条推文,这意味着当有人发推文时,我希望看到该推文。 但是,我可以使用twitter4j库从新闻提要中获取推文。这是代码。 我发现必须使用Streaming API才能实时访问tweets。但是我在Java中找不到任何示例代码来访问深绿色时间推文。 问题答案: Twitter4j提供了示例,其中一个正是您要查找的示例,但是您需要更改行号 与 如果没有,则必须配置属性文件。之
问题内容: 有没有为接口方法创建默认实现的首选方法或样式?假设我有一个常用的接口,在90%的情况下,我想要的功能是相同的。 我的第一个直觉是用静态方法创建一个具体的类。然后,当我想要默认功能时,可以将功能委托给静态方法。 这是一个简单的示例: 接口 方法的具体实现 使用默认功能的具体实现 这里有更好的方法吗? 编辑 在看到了一些建议的解决方案之后,我认为我应该更加清楚自己的意图。本质上,我正在尝试